使用ProxyFactoryBean是创建我们程序外的被通知的bean的好办法,不过,使用ProxyFactoryBean还是需要相当多的配置(为每一个bean进行一次配置),如果程序中大量使用了AOP ,创建这些配置还是相当费时的,好在Spring为我们提供了和自动创配Bean类似的自动代理机制BeanNameAutoProxyCreator(bean名自动代理生成器),使用方法如下:
BeanOne.java
package
ch7.BeanNameAutoProxyCreator;
public class BeanOne ... {
public void foo()...{
System.out.println("foo1");
}
}
public class BeanOne ... {
public void foo()...{
System.out.println("foo1");
}
}
BeanTwo.java
package
ch7.BeanNameAutoProxyCreator;
public class BeanTwo ... {
public void foo()
public class BeanTwo ... {
public void foo()